HeightDifficultyConfirmations
5464310.003568408
Latest Transactions
RecipientsAmount (STC)
10.00000000
22239744.00000000
22227248.00000000
21990144.00000000
21893088.00000000
21600248.00000000
21528252.00000000
21498848.00000000
21129320.00000000
2898960.00000000
2249232.00000000
295904.00000000
258208.00000000
21585950.00000000
2300010.50000000